    The cameras after two weeks make you feel a little strange, even if they are for your own safety, it stops you from being totally relaxed. The Ac in the room with bamboo roof and on sunset side…it’s time for an update. It was the only issue and otherwise a great experience. If you are working in the room, you need to be able to cool down and stay cool inside.

    The hotel grounds are absolutely beautiful and the pictures don’t do justice. The garden was created and maintained with such love. The place makes you feel home and happy to return. The pool is gorgeous, you swim with petals falling on your head. Location is really nothing with a bike, 5 mins and your are in central town. Really good Sushi restraunt opposite the hotel. Food and prices at the hotel are also decent, very comfortable to have breakfast brought to your room.

    Unfortunately the Indonesian tourism boom and construction madness just ruined our stay. It doesn't matter how nice a property is, if we're unable to rest properly. I have been to Bali in 2013, as well as 2 trips in 2023. The differences are abysmal. We don't remember having a moment of silence throughout our stay, so we ended up sleeping late, waking up early, and not being able to rest during the day either in our room. Summing up, the disturbances were : Friday evening - either a neighbor or the property itself conducted late night construction, with hacking, hammering and similar noises until really late (1-2AM). Loud traffic noise. Saturday afternoon - several people working on the roofs, talking, as well as construction noise. Saturday evening - road construction going on all night, which curiously started at 1AM. Including heavy duty trucks dumping rocks and other materials, as well as drilling and other construction noises. Sunday afternoon - several people working on the roofs, talking, as well as construction noise. Sunday evening - well, there was no construction on our last evening. However, animals are probably scared of all the noises mentioned before. So when there is no human-generated noise, animals will be animals. We were woken up by a shouting contest between a bird, a dog and a rooster, from 4AM until the morning. The roads and pedestrian pavements nearby the property are undergoing major development, so this source of noise will probably continue for quite some time. It doesn't help that the roof of the Villa is thin and made of wood. And it doesn't really matter that the Villa is far from the road. The noise can still be heard like it's really close. Fortunately our stay was only 3 nights, or we would have probably cut it short.
